How does progesterone affect pregnancy?

One of the tasks of progesterone is to build up the endometrium so that the fertilized egg has a place to gain a foothold. And for 9 months, reduce the contractile activity of the uterus to maintain pregnancy. Thanks to progesterone, the uterus grows and the mammary glands enlarge, preparing the woman for the process of lactation.

Why is progesterone needed?

Progesterone plays a very important role in a woman’s reproductive function, not only during planning, but also during pregnancy.

Progesterone helps create an environment in the uterus favorable for conception, and also helps to increase the survival of the fertilized egg and its normal implantation.

Progesterone strengthens and preserves the secretory endometrium in the uterus , which supports the embryo during pregnancy.

Progesterone prevents premature rejection of the secretory endometrium.

Since progesterone prevents the rejection of the endometrium, in which the fertilized egg is implanted, low progesterone levels during the first few weeks of pregnancy can lead to miscarriages.

Indicators before conception

In the follicular phase, the range of hormone concentrations is from 0.34 to 2.24 nmol/l, in the ovulation phase, progesterone production is higher - from 0.49 to 9.42 nmol/l, in the luteal phase the values ​​​​reach a critical level - 6.98 to 56.64 nmol/l.

To complete the picture, a woman is tested for progesterone up to three times per cycle. Since a change in indications may adversely affect conception.

On what day of the cycle should I take it?

The complexity of the analysis lies in the fact that, depending on the symptoms, it is taken on different days of the cycle. If menstruation fails, blood is donated three times: a week after the start of the menstrual cycle, on the 15th and 20th day.

Without any suspicious symptoms, it is recommended to take the test on days 20–23 of the cycle.

Submission rules


A couple of days before the test, it is advisable to avoid stressful situations, physical activity, and temporarily abstain from sexual intercourse. A couple of days before the study, they give up alcoholic drinks, coffee, medications, and also do not smoke for three days. You should not eat on the day of the test.
